## Configuration

The Cartavio tile cache sits between the renderer and object storage. Defaults live in `cache.defaults.yml`; overrides go in `.env`.

Key settings: `TILE_CACHE_TTL` (seconds, default 3600), `TILE_CACHE_MAX_MB` (default 2048), `TILE_CACHE_REGION` (must match the renderer pool).

Support note: a cold cache after restart is expected; warmup takes ~10 minutes. The cache authenticates to the eviction service with a signing secret, set on the next line of the env file.

vault entry, yahif-yajep: COURIER_KEY29=b802bdf8034096b65a51c6ba5abe2

**Ticket: Config drift in Haulrick driver-assignment heuristic**

Staging and prod have diverged on the weighting parameters for the driver-assignment heuristic, so assignments differ between environments for identical inputs. This confuses anyone validating fixes against staging. Please compare both environments carefully before touching the scorer, and note that prod is the source of truth. For reference, the intended production values are listed below.

settings of fafog-haduf:
ZORIX_PIN=4648
ZORIX_METRICS_HOST=metrics.zorix.paliqsys.corp
ZORIX_LOG_LEVEL=info
ZORIX_TENANT=druix

Sessions enter the proctor-review queue when the automated checks flag an anomaly. Normal queue depth is under 200; above 500, review latency exceeds the 30-minute SLA and candidates start contacting support. First, confirm the reviewer pool is fully staffed in the assignment dashboard. If staffing is normal, check for a stuck dispatcher — a single wedged worker can hold hundreds of sessions. Restarting the dispatcher is safe and does not lose queue state. Detailed drain and escalation procedures are on the page below.

runbook for badug-kadup: https://confluence.zemvarlabs.internal/projects/browse/display/projects/bd1b

During a contractor's first week at Torvale Works, night shift staff should treat them as escorted visitors regardless of daytime arrangements. Contractors arriving after 22:00 must sign the night register and remain with a staff member at all times. Do not lend personal badges. If escort is unavailable, admit them through the side entrance using the code below.

staff pass of kawip-hawef = bdg-QLP-2